Essential Duties and Responsibilities: Provide the first contact for patients who call or come in to schedule an appointment or inquire about our services. Screen calls and facilitate excellent service by providing the information necessary to secure an appointment. Schedule and confirm appointments and conduct outbound retention calls to patients. Coordinate provider’s schedule and ensure the smooth and efficient flow of patient care while in the office. Check patients in and out, collect and record payments, track revenue and accounting activities to include: petty cash reconciliation, end of day close, bank deposits, posting of charges, entering invoices, payments and insurance claim processing.
